The Common Law Admission Test 2012 (CLAT 2012) is an all India entrance examination conducted by 11 National Law Universities for admissions to their under-graduate and post-graduate degree programmes (LL.B & LL.M). This yearCommon Law Admission Test 2012 is Organising by National Law University, Jodhpur.

National Law University, Jodhpur invites application from eligible candidate for the CLAT 2012 for the admission on 1500 seats available in the 11 participating Universities. All necessary details about CLAT 2012 is as below :-

Important Dates:
  • Application Starts From :- 02nd January, 2012
  • Last Date for Submission of Application :- 31st March, 2012
  • Date of Entrance Examination :- 13th May, 2012
Eligibility for CLAT 2012 :- Candidates willing to apply must passed 10+2 or equivalent examination from any recognized Board or University with 50% marks (47% for SC/ST/OBC & PH candiates). Candiates appearing for 10+2 can also apply, but they have to passed out their examination before admission process.

Age Limit for CLAT 2012 :- Maxium age of limit of CLAT examination is 20 years for all candiates and 22 years for reserved category candidates.

Participating Universities :- NLSIU - Bangalore, NALSAR - Hyderabad, NLIU - Bhopal, WBNUJS - Kolkata, NLU - Jodhpur, HNLU - Raipur, GNLU - Gandhinagar, RMLNLU - Lucknow, RGNLU - Patiala, CNLU - Patna and NUALS - Kochi

CLAT 2012 Examination Scheme :- Common Law Admission Test paper will obtain 200 marks weighate, consist of English, General Knowledge, Maths, Reasoning and Common Law Knowledge, Constitution of India related questions. English-40 marks, General Knowledge-50 marks, Maths-20 marks, Reasoning-45 marks and Law Awareness-45 marks. Duration of the examination - 2.00 Hours.

COMMON ADDMISSION TEST (CAT)




Common Admission Test, popularly known as CAT, conducted by the Indian Institutes of Management (IIMs) for selecting eligible candidates for admission into various post graduate level management programmes, might be held twice in a year. The scores of CAT is used as part of the selection procedure for short-listing candidates desiring to pursue business administration programmes in the IIMs, Faculty of Management Studies (FMS), Indian Institutes of Technology (IITs), Indian Institute of Science (IISc), and numerous other top B-schools in India and abroad.

As per sources, the organizers of the reputed computerized test are on talks about making the test available biannually for the convenience of the working class aspirants, who are left with no choice but to wait for an entire year for appearing in the exam and wait for the declaration of the results. The organizers are planning to implement the twice-a-year pattern from next year.

With the increase in the number of institutes taking CAT scores in consideration as part of the screening procedure, the number of students sitting for the test is also increasing drastically. According to an IIM official, the number of working class candidates desiring to take the CAT is considerable, but the routine professional life urges them to drop back.

Confirming the news, Prof Jankiraman Moorthy, Convenor for CAT 2012, said that the decision to make CAT biannual will benefit the candidates, from the working class, willing to appear for the test. However, the plan is only in its initial stage and no final decision has been made so far, added Moorthy. Details on the testing pattern, timing of the second testing session, etc. will be settled with only after the ongoing discussions come to an end.

With the establishment of CAT biannually, working professionals would certainly take this news as a positive step. They would be able to apply and sit for the CAT as per their convenience, depending upon the semester in which they wish to take admission - Fall or Spring, not just in institutes in India, but across universities and colleges on foreign lands.

Result - CAT 2011 Results Will be Announced on January 11, 2012

Common Addmission Test (CAT)


The months’ long hard work and practice of cracking a plethora of some of the toughest questions will finally come to an end on January 11, 2012. Yes, that is the date declared by the Indian Institutes of Management (IIMs) for announcing the results of Common Admission Test, popularly known as CAT, 2011. Regarded as one of the best and hardest entrance examinations in India to fight for a seat in one of the esteemed IIMs, the result will decide the fate of over 2 lakh candidates who took the test this year.

With just 40 days to go, the wait seems longer than before, as candidates keep their fingers crossed hoping to make it at least to one of these prestigious B-schools. Besides the IIMs, CAT opens the doors of admission into as many as top 25 good quality B-schools. Once the IIMs declare the CAT 2011 results, IIMs and other top MBA schools will start the process of short-listing candidates for Group Discussion (GD), Personal Interview (PI), and Writing Ability Test (WAT).

This year, CAT saw a total of 2,05,345 candidates registering their candidature for 2011 test. The exam was successfully conducted by the Indian Institutes of Management (IIMs) and Prometric, the service provider for the computer-based CAT. The test was held over a period of 20 days from October 22 to November 18, in 68 centers across 36 cities. Three new centers, namely, Bhilai, Jamshedpur, and Jammu, were added to the existing list of centers.

Further, two new state-of-the-art testing facilities were established in Gurgaon and Hyderabad by Prometric, this year. Candidates, who took the test, this year, saw a number of changes in the CAT. The testing sections were cut short to two from the prevailing three, while the check-in time was reduced by half an hour.
